Transaction 152d64c7a811000087a5f55c16759889a64fcd9bef24d02efc24a329d6f3fa56
1 Input
1 Output
-
152d64c7a811000087a5f55c16759889a64fcd9bef24d02efc24a329d6f3fa56:0
- value
- 3647679
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ecbf9608bc9682f3511c771b85eed8b2a00919df
- address
- bc1qajlevz9uj6p0x5guwudctmkck2sqjxwlwzv4qp